East India Company Medal For Seringapatam, Bronze, 41.25g, Obv: the British Lion defeating the Tiger of Mysore (Tipoo Sultan) with the date of the capture of the fortress 4th May 1799 inscribed below; Rev: depicts the assault on Seringapatam, The British and Native troops of the Bengal Presidency engaged in the siege and who took part in the renewed campaign against Tipu Sultan were awarded this medal in 1808 by the East India Company. MYB 79. Extremely Fine, Very Rare.

Nawanagar, Gold (60% on outer surface) Medal, 27.71g with ribbon, Colonel H. H. Shri Sir Ranjitsinhji Vibhaji II Jam Saheb of Nawanagar, Order of Merit, Full size Gold Medal, Obv: portrait of the ruler, with Order Of Merit Nawanagar State inscribed around, Rev: standing figures of a knight and justice and seated figures of an angel with a child and beauty with a hound. Loyalty, Philanthropy, Charity, Fidelity on separate scrolls below, with a First Class bar, These medals were intended for awarding state subjects and State Forces for distinguished services. T.Mac 203. Extremely Fine, Very Rare.
